Beispielanalyse der Verwendung von nmap-converter zur Konvertierung von nmap-Scan-Ergebnis-XML in XLS

WBOY
Freigeben: 2023-05-17 13:04:19
nach vorne
1755 Leute haben es durchsucht

Verwenden Sie den NMAP-Konverter, um NMAP-Scan-Ergebnisse in XML in XLS zu konvertieren ist .nmap. Die drei Formate .xml und .gnmap sind mit vielen unnötigen Informationen vermischt, was sehr umständlich zu verarbeiten ist. Die Ausgabeergebnisse werden in Excel-Tabellen konvertiert, um die spätere Ausgabe zu verarbeiten. Ein technischer Experte hat ein Python-Skript zum Konvertieren von NMAP-Berichten in XLS bereitgestellt. Heute können wir dieses Skript zum Konvertieren von NMAP-Berichten in XLS-Dateien verwenden.

2. nmap-converter

Die Adresse dieses Projekts lautet: https://github.com/mrschyte/nmap-converter

2) Umgebungsanforderungen

(1) Python (Python2.7 für diesen Test)

(2) Hängt von Python-Modulen ab: python-libnmap, XlsxWriter, Installation: pip install python-libnmap, pip install XlsxWriter

3) Verwendung: nmap-converter.py [-h] [-o XLS] XML [XML . ..]

Beispiel: nmap-converter.py -o test.xlsx test.xml

(test.xlsx ist das konvertierte Excel, test.xml ist das Nmap-Ausgabe-XML-Formatergebnis)

3 Verwenden Sie den tatsächlichen Kampf

1) Dateien vorbereiten

Legen Sie das Python-Konvertierungsskript nmap-converter.py und die vom Nmap-Scanning ausgegebene XML-Datei test.xml in dasselbe Verzeichnis.

2) Öffnen Sie cmd und führen Sie Folgendes aus: nmap-converter.py -o test. xlsx test.xml,

3) Konvertierungsergebnisse

Nach Abschluss der Konvertierung wird eine test.xlsx-Datei im Verzeichnis generiert und kann mit Excel verarbeitet werden.

Das obige ist der detaillierte Inhalt vonBeispielanalyse der Verwendung von nmap-converter zur Konvertierung von nmap-Scan-Ergebnis-XML in XLS. Für weitere Informationen folgen Sie bitte anderen verwandten Artikeln auf der PHP chinesischen Website!

Verwandte Etiketten:
Quelle:yisu.com
Erklärung dieser Website
Der Inhalt dieses Artikels wird freiwillig von Internetnutzern beigesteuert und das Urheberrecht liegt beim ursprünglichen Autor. Diese Website übernimmt keine entsprechende rechtliche Verantwortung. Wenn Sie Inhalte finden, bei denen der Verdacht eines Plagiats oder einer Rechtsverletzung besteht, wenden Sie sich bitte an admin@php.cn
Beliebte Tutorials
Mehr>
Neueste Downloads
Mehr>
Web-Effekte
Quellcode der Website
Website-Materialien
Frontend-Vorlage